STM32/STM8技术william hill官网
直播中

陈珂瑾

7年用户 171经验值
私信 关注
[问答]

stm32f030C8作为时钟计算时间MCU的时间与电脑的时间不一致

使用STM32f030c8作为内部时钟计时,保存年月日,时分秒,但是有个问题就是间隔一段事件后,MCU的时间与电脑的时间不一致,而且每过去一个或者两个小时,mcu即将慢1秒或者是间隔两个小时

回帖(5)

凌流浪

2018-11-9 09:05:19
本帖最后由 任风吹吹 于 2016-11-23 11:04 编辑

楼主所说是RTC校准问题吧? 建议使用外部LSE 32.768K,参考所使用的晶振手册,配置合理的负载电容,保**震荡波形。确保PPM值在合适范围内。其次百度下有关RTC校准的相关参考文档。
举报

王聪

2018-11-9 09:24:42
帮顶,帮顶
举报

陈珂瑾

2018-11-9 09:32:08
引用: 充电搜索 发表于 2018-11-9 08:32
本帖最后由 任风吹吹 于 2016-11-23 11:04 编辑

楼主所说是RTC校准问题吧? 建议使用外部LSE 32.768K,参考所使用的晶振手册,配置合理的负载电容,保**震荡波形。确保PPM值在合适范围内。其次百度下有关RTC校准的相关参考文档。

没有,是单纯的使用定时器TIm 然后向上计时,1ms中断一次,作为基时
举报

陈利妮

2018-11-9 09:48:08
内部时钟驱动计时么
举报

杨丽

2018-11-9 09:54:47
内部RC振荡器提供的8M时钟不是非常的精确的。如果要时间准备,还是得用RTC,内部或者外部都可以。
举报

更多回帖

发帖
×
20
完善资料,
赚取积分